College Goal Sunday


College Goal Sunday is dedicated to guiding students and their families through the paperwork required to apply for financial aid. College Goal Sunday is for all families who want assistance in completing the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) form. Financial aid officers and other qualified professionals volunteer their time to ensure students receive assistance in understanding and completing the paperwork necessary to receive financial aid.

Who should attend?
College Goal Sunday is open to everyone, including students from all income levels and college-going traditions, and traditional and nontraditional students. The program is open to all higher-education-bound students and their families. It is an excellent opportunity to network and have many of your financial aid questions answered!

What to bring:
People can use different pieces of financial information to complete the FAFSA. Bring tax returns, W-2's, tribal income, other aid-TANF, child support, other benefits, investment information, last year's tax return or even last year's ending pay stub. All information reviewed by the College Goal Sunday volunteers will be kept private and confidential and will not be used for any purpose other than helping the students and families apply for financial aid.
